10. TAG Heuer Monaco

TAG Heuer Monaco
tagheuer.com

The TAG Heuer Monaco is a legendary and iconic timepiece that has left an indelible mark on the world of watchmaking and popular culture. It is celebrated for its distinctive square case, which defied traditional watch design when it was first introduced in 1969. The watch gained further fame when it was worn by Steve McQueen in the classic racing film "Le Mans," solidifying its status as a symbol of style and innovation.

Key features and details of the TAG Heuer Monaco:

Square Case: The most striking feature of the Monaco is its square case, a bold departure from the round cases that were prevalent at the time of its release. The watch's square shape continues to set it apart from other timepieces.

Automatic Movement: The Monaco is typically powered by an automatic movement, ensuring precise timekeeping without the need for a battery. The movement is often visible through an exhibition case back, allowing watch enthusiasts to appreciate the watch's inner workings.

Chronograph Function: The watch includes a chronograph, with sub-dials for measuring elapsed time, making it a practical tool for racing and timing.

Blue Dial: The classic Monaco features a blue dial, which has become synonymous with the watch's identity. The dial often includes red accents and luminescent markers for excellent readability.

Sapphire Crystal: The watch features scratch-resistant sapphire crystal, protecting the dial and ensuring its durability.

Stainless Steel Case: The case is made from high-quality stainless steel, offering a blend of sturdiness and a sleek, polished finish.

Leather Strap: The Monaco is usually paired with a leather strap, adding elegance and comfort for daily wear.

Water Resistance: While not designed for deep-sea diving, the watch often offers basic water resistance, making it suitable for everyday wear and exposure to splashes.

Heritage and Legacy: The TAG Heuer Monaco's association with motorsports, Steve McQueen, and the "Le Mans" film has elevated it to a symbol of style and coolness, contributing to its enduring popularity.

Variety of Models: Over the years, TAG Heuer has released various models and limited editions within the Monaco collection, offering a range of styles and features to cater to different preferences.

The TAG Heuer Monaco is a watch that stands out not only for its unconventional design but also for its rich history and cultural significance. It continues to be a favorite among watch enthusiasts, racing aficionados, and individuals who appreciate the fusion of style and functionality. Whether you're a motorsports enthusiast or simply looking for a distinctive and timeless timepiece, the Monaco embodies TAG Heuer's commitment to innovation and enduring style in the world of Swiss watchmaking.

8. Tudor Pelagos

Tudor Pelagos
tudorwatch.com

The Tudor Pelagos is a remarkable and highly regarded dive watch that combines style, functionality, and precision. As part of the Tudor Heritage collection, the Pelagos pays homage to Tudor's rich heritage in producing reliable and robust diving timepieces while incorporating modern innovations.

Key features and details of the Tudor Pelagos:

Diver's Watch: The Pelagos is a professional diver's watch with a water resistance rating of up to 500 meters (1,640 feet). It is designed to withstand the most demanding underwater conditions and is equipped with essential diving features.

Automatic Movement: The watch is powered by a reliable and accurate automatic movement, ensuring precise timekeeping without the need for a battery. The movement is often visible through the exhibition case back.

Helium Escape Valve: An essential feature for saturation divers, the Pelagos often includes a helium escape valve to allow the release of trapped helium during decompression.

Luminous Markers and Hands: The watch features generously applied luminescent material on the hands, indices, and bezel, providing exceptional visibility in low-light and underwater conditions.

Ceramic Bezel: The watch's unidirectional rotating bezel is made of scratch-resistant ceramic, which is both durable and highly resistant to wear and tear.

Titanium Case: The Pelagos usually boasts a lightweight and robust titanium case, making it comfortable for long-term wear while offering outstanding strength.

Adjustable Clasp: The watch is equipped with an innovative and patented self-adjusting clasp, ensuring a secure and comfortable fit over a diving suit.

Sapphire Crystal: The watch features a scratch-resistant sapphire crystal that protects the dial from potential damage.

Variety of Dial Colors: Tudor offers various dial colors, including black, blue, and matte blue, allowing wearers to select their preferred style.

Date Function: The Pelagos often includes a practical date window, adding everyday functionality to its dive-oriented features.

The Tudor Pelagos is not just a dive watch; it's a comprehensive tool designed to meet the demanding needs of professional divers while retaining a distinctive and stylish appearance. Whether you're an underwater explorer, an adventure enthusiast, or simply a watch aficionado, the Pelagos embodies Tudor's commitment to precision, durability, and timeless design in the world of Swiss watchmaking.

7. Santos De Cartier

Santos De Cartier
cartier.com

The Santos de Cartier is a timeless and iconic watch collection that has left an indelible mark on the world of luxury timepieces. Introduced in 1904, the Santos de Cartier was not only a pioneering design but also a symbol of innovation in watchmaking. It was created for Brazilian aviator Alberto Santos-Dumont, one of the early pioneers of aviation, who required a watch that allowed him to check the time while flying.

Key features and details of the Santos de Cartier:

Rectangular Case: The most distinguishing feature of the Santos de Cartier is its rectangular case with rounded corners. This groundbreaking design defied the traditional round watch cases of the time and set a new standard for watch aesthetics.

Variety of Sizes: The Santos de Cartier collection is available in various sizes, making it suitable for both men and women. The sizes range from small to large, ensuring that individuals can choose a size that suits their wrist.

Automatic Movement: Many models within the collection are powered by automatic movements, delivering reliable and precise timekeeping without the need for a battery. Some models also feature quartz movements for added convenience.

Sapphire Crystal: The watch is equipped with scratch-resistant sapphire crystal, ensuring the dial remains clear and unblemished.

Classic and Modern Variations: Cartier offers classic models with timeless designs and modern variations that incorporate contemporary materials and features. The watch is known for its adaptability to changing fashion trends while retaining its core design elements.

Interchangeable Straps: The Santos de Cartier often features a quick-change strap system, allowing wearers to effortlessly switch between leather straps and metal bracelets, enhancing the watch's versatility.

Roman Numeral Hour Markers: The classic Santos de Cartier models typically feature Roman numeral hour markers, adding an elegant and timeless touch to the dial.

Water Resistance: While not designed for deep-sea diving, the watch offers basic water resistance, making it suitable for everyday wear and exposure to splashes.

Variety of Models: The Santos de Cartier collection includes various models, including the Santos-Dumont, Santos 100, Santos de Cartier Galbée, and others, catering to different style preferences and case sizes.

The Santos de Cartier is more than just a watch; it's a symbol of style, innovation, and pioneering design. It continues to be a favorite among watch enthusiasts, fashion-forward individuals, and those who appreciate the fusion of elegance and functionality. Whether you're seeking a classic and timeless timepiece or a modern and adaptable accessory, the Santos de Cartier embodies Cartier's dedication to luxury and enduring style in the world of high-end watchmaking.

6.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ional

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ional Co-Axial
omegawatches.com

The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ional is an iconic and historic timepiece that holds a unique place in the world of watchmaking. Celebrated as the "Moonwatch," this watch became legendary for its role in space exploration and its presence during NASA's missions to the moon. Its remarkable journey to the lunar surface, worn by astronauts, has solidified its status as an enduring symbol of human achievement and precision.

Key features and details of the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ional:

Moonwatch Heritage: The Omega Speedmaster Professional was the first watch worn on the moon during the Apollo 11 mission in 1969. It has since been part of all six lunar landings, earning it the "Moonwatch" nickname and a reputation for unparalleled reliability.

Manual-Winding Movement: The Moonwatch is powered by a high-precision manual-winding movement. This movement is not only celebrated for its accuracy but also for its connection to the early days of space exploration when electronic movements were less reliable.

Hesalite Crystal: The watch features a hesalite (acrylic) crystal, which was chosen for its shatter-resistant properties in the extreme conditions of space. A modern sapphire crystal version is also available for those who prefer a more scratch-resistant option.

Iconic Design: The Moonwatch boasts a timeless and instantly recognizable design with its black dial, contrasting white hands and hour markers, and the signature tachymeter scale on the bezel. The watch often includes the NASA logo and "The First Watch Worn on the Moon" text on the case back.

Stainless Steel Case and Bracelet: The case and bracelet are made from robust and corrosion-resistant stainless steel, ensuring the watch's durability and longevity.

Luminous Markers and Hands: The watch features luminescent material on the hands and markers, ensuring excellent visibility in low-light conditions.

Variety of Models: Omega offers a variety of Moonwatch models, including the classic Speedmaster Professional, the Speedmaster Professional "Sapphire Sandwich" with a display case back, and the Speedmaster Professional Moonphase, among others.

Water Resistance: With water resistance up to 50 meters (167 feet), the watch is suitable for daily wear and can withstand splashes and rain.

Historical Significance: The Moonwatch's place in history and connection to space exploration make it a cherished collector's item, attracting enthusiasts and individuals who appreciate its legacy.

The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ional is more than a watch; it's a symbol of human achievement and precision. It is the choice of astronauts and watch enthusiasts alike, celebrated for its historical significance, timeless design, and unwavering accuracy. Whether you're an avid space enthusiast, a watch collector, or simply someone who appreciates a piece of history on their wrist, the Moonwatch embodies Omega's commitment to excellence in the world of watchmaking.

2. J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ds

J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ds 1
J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ds 2
jaeger-lecoultre.com

The J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ds is a remarkable timepiece that combines elegance, innovation, and versatility. This watch is part of the iconic Reverso collection by Jaeger-LeCoultre, known for its unique reversible case that allows wearers to display two different dials, making it perfect for those who appreciate classic style and dual time zone functionality.

Key features and details of the J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ds:

Reversible Case: The hallmark feature of the Reverso collection is the reversible case. The watch's case can be flipped to reveal a second dial on the reverse side, offering two distinct looks and the ability to track a second time zone.

Manual-Winding Movement: The watch is powered by a high-precision manual-winding movement, known for its exceptional accuracy and the ability to appreciate the craftsmanship through an exhibition case back.

Small Seconds Sub-Dial: The watch features a small seconds sub-dial on one of the dials, adding a subtle and practical complication that enhances timekeeping precision.

Classic Design: The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ds boasts an Art Deco-inspired design, with elegant, minimalist dials, applied hour markers, and dauphine-style hands. The reversible case is often polished to perfection.

Sapphire Crystal: The watch features scratch-resistant sapphire crystal on both sides of the case, ensuring the dials remain clear and unblemished.

Stainless Steel Case: The case is typically made from stainless steel, a durable and corrosion-resistant material that enhances the watch's longevity.

Leather Strap: The watch is usually paired with a genuine leather strap, adding a touch of sophistication and comfort for everyday wear.

Water Resistance: While not designed for water-related activities, the watch offers basic water resistance, protecting it from splashes and rain.

Variety of Models: Jaeger-LeCoultre offers various Reverso models, including different case sizes, materials, and complications, catering to different style preferences and needs.

The JLC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ds is a watch that marries classic elegance with innovation. It's ideal for individuals who appreciate timeless design and the convenience of a dual time zone watch. Whether you're dressing for a formal event or simply looking for a watch with a unique twist, the Reverso Classic Duoface Small Seconds embodies Jaeger-LeCoultre's commitment to craftsmanship and innovation in the world of Swiss watchmaking.

1. Rolex Submariner

Rolex Submariner
rolex.com

The Rolex Submariner is an iconic and legendary dive watch that has become a symbol of Rolex's watchmaking excellence and adventure. Since its introduction in 1953, the Submariner has set the standard for what a high-quality dive watch should be, and it has earned a well-deserved place in the world of horology and pop culture.

Key features and details of the Rolex Submariner:

Diver's Watch Heritage: The Submariner is a quintessential dive watch, designed for underwater exploration. It boasts a water resistance rating of up to 300 meters (1,000 feet) in most models, and the Submariner Date extends this to 300 meters as well.

Automatic Movement: The Submariner is equipped with a self-winding automatic movement, known for its reliability and precision. Rolex movements undergo stringent testing and are often COSC-certified for their accuracy.

Rotating Bezel: The watch features a unidirectional rotating bezel with a ceramic insert on most modern models. This bezel allows divers to track elapsed time underwater, ensuring safety during their dives.

Luminous Markers and Hands: The hands and hour markers are coated with Rolex's proprietary Chromalight luminescent material, providing exceptional visibility in low-light conditions, including underwater.

Oyster Case: The Submariner is housed in Rolex's Oyster case, known for its robustness and water resistance. The Oyster case features a screw-down crown, ensuring a hermetically sealed environment for the movement.

Cyclops Date Window: The Submariner Date version includes a date function with a Cyclops lens, which magnifies the date for easy reading.

Stainless Steel Construction: The watch is constructed from high-quality stainless steel, ensuring durability and a polished finish. Some models are available in precious metals like yellow gold or two-tone combinations.

Scratch-Resistant Sapphire Crystal: The watch is fitted with a scratch-resistant sapphire crystal, providing clear protection for the dial.

Variety of Models: Rolex offers a variety of Submariner models, each with distinct features, including different materials, bezel colors, and dials.

Cultural Icon: The Rolex Submariner has been worn by numerous celebrities, explorers, and actors, cementing its place in pop culture and making it one of the most recognizable luxury watches in the world.

The Rolex Submariner is not just a timepiece; it's a symbol of adventure and watchmaking excellence. It is a favorite among divers, watch enthusiasts, and those who appreciate classic design and precision. Whether you're diving into the depths of the ocean, dressing for a special occasion, or simply looking for a reliable and iconic watch, the Submariner embodies Rolex's dedication to crafting exceptional timepieces that withstand the test of time.
